Use Caution with Thanksgiving Cooking.Thanksgiving is one of the most popular days for cooking in the country. It also is the leading day for home cooking fires.

 With pots boiling, ovens baking and skillets sizzling, Thanksgiving can be a hazardous day in the kitchen.
So much so, in fact, that the National Fire Protection Association says that with so many more people cooking on Thanksgiving than on a typical day, Americans are twice as likely to have a home fire on the holiday than any other day of the year.
Thanksgiving kitchens can be filled with inexperienced, busy or distracted chefs, which can spell disaster.

Windows 7 to be translated into 10 African languages

The Windows 7 operating system, released by Microsoft, will be translated into 10 African languages. Translation teams from South Africa, Kenya, Nigeria and Ethiopia have already started translating Windows 7 and the upcoming Office 2010 productivity suite into languages like Sesotho sa Leboa, Setswana, isiXhosa, isiZulu, Afrikaans, Hausa, Igbo, Yoruba, kiSwahili and Amharic.

Jennifer Hudson to play Winnie Mandela in an upcoming Movie"Winnie"


It appears that multi-award winning singer and actress Jennifer Hudson, has got a new project to start very soon. According to eonline.com, the former “American Idol” finalist has recently signed up to play Winnie Mandela in an upcoming movie.

The movie is said to be a biopic, all about Winnie Mandela, who is the wife of former president of South Africa Nelson Mandela. The drama will reportedly be based on the Anne du Preez Bezrob biography, “Winnie Mandela: A Life.”

And it appears that Hudson is not worried at all, about taking on the challenging role. Hudson says that she was compelled and moved when she read the script for the movie. She also says that she is honoured to be asked to portray Winnie.

Say You’re One of Them


Nigerian-born Jesuit priest Uwem Akpan gives us a stark reminder of just how fortunate we are in his book Say You’re One of Them, a collection of short stories detailing the terrifying lives led by African children that are fictional only in name.
Say You’re One of Them tells the shocking and heart-wrenching stories of children from five different African nations. Though the stories are fiction, Uwem Akpan–and anyone who has spent any time in Africa–knows that they are not only all too true, but are just a sampling of the hell that is life for children in Africa.

Uwem Akpan’s heartbreaking 2008 debut, now available in paperback, was a selection of Oprah’s Book Club.
